Commit Graph

4 Commits

Author SHA1 Message Date
Chevdor 3c5fcbe637 Add check runtimes GH Workflow (#2252)
This PR introduces:
- a new script 
- a new GH Workflow 
- runtime reference spec files for `rococo` and `westend`

It brings a mechanism to check that part(s) of the runtimes' metadata
that should not change over time, actually did not change over time.

Ideally, the GHW should trigger when a release is edited but GH seem to
[have an issue](https://github.com/orgs/community/discussions/47794)
that prevents the trigger from working. This is why the check has been
implemented as `workflow_dispatch` for a start.

The `workflow_dispatch` requires a `release_id` that can be found using:
```
curl -s -H "Authorization: Bearer ${GITHUB_TOKEN}" \
   https://api.github.com/repos/paritytech/polkadot-sdk/releases | \
   jq '.[] | { name: .name, id: .id }'
```
as documented in the workflow.

A sample run can be seen
[here](https://github.com/chevdor/polkadot-sdk/actions/runs/6811176342).
2023-12-13 11:28:34 +02:00
Lulu a00a767604 Make publish CI consistant and bump to v0.3.0 (#2453) 2023-11-24 10:07:35 +01:00
Alexander Samusev 5b0622bc4d [CI] Prepare CI for Merge Queues (#2308)
PR prepares CI to the GitHub Merge Queues. All github actions that were
running in PR adjusted so they can run in the merge queues. Zombienet
jobs will do nothing during PRs but they will run during merge queues.

Jobs that will be skipped during PR:
 - all zombienet jobs
 - all publish docker jobs

Jobs that will be skipped during merge queue:
 - check-labels
 - check-prdoc
 - pr-custom-review
 - review trigger

cc https://github.com/paritytech/ci_cd/issues/862
2023-11-15 14:28:32 +01:00
Lulu 495d24d730 Add ci check for parity-publish and fix current check issues (#1887)
Co-authored-by: Sergejs Kostjucenko <85877331+sergejparity@users.noreply.github.com>
Co-authored-by: Bastian Köcher <info@kchr.de>
2023-10-31 18:04:31 +00:00